Origins and Meaning

The surname Menšík is of Czech origin and is derived from the word "menší," which translates to "smaller" or "lesser" in English. This suggests that individuals with the surname Menšík may have been associated with being of smaller stature or having a lesser status within their community. It is also possible that the surname was used to distinguish between individuals with similar names, with the addition of "Menšík" denoting the younger or lesser individual.

Distribution and prevalence

The surname Menšík is relatively uncommon, with a total incidence of 1,539 individuals bearing this surname across the Czech Republic, Slovakia, and Croatia. The highest incidence of the Menšík surname is in the Czech Republic, with 1,510 individuals having this surname. In Slovakia, there are only 28 individuals with the surname Menšík, while Croatia has the fewest individuals with only 1 person bearing this surname.
